The truth, the truths of life: this is the reason and purpose of the search of the young protagonist of this concept album, as well as the first full-length album, by dredg (to be pronounced with the G of "garage" and not of "giraffe").
Leitmotif begins with a philosophical vein. Symbol Song is precisely the symbol song of the whole album, it overwhelms you and immerses you into the dredg-sound characterized by precision (nothing is left to chance and to noise), a touch of improvisation, melody and power (Take these words, be on your way you will find your now). Dredg don’t like to label themselves, they emphasize this in every interview. It's clear that theirs is a rock-oriented style, but they also demonstrate with great eloquence how they do not impose limits in their composition.In the "second movement", Crosswind Minuet, it is like witnessing a composition in real-time: a simple and direct drum line precedes the entrance of the bass, which then opens up to the piano groove (played by the drummer himself, Dino Campanella).
After only 1 minute and 32 seconds of listening, enveloped by the hypnotic and sober mix, everything stops to give space to "Traversing Through The Arctic Cold We Search For The Spirit Of Yuta", a sort of acoustic track similar to Acoustic Alchemy (with the necessary differences in composition and sound). A track over 6 minutes long in which the four Californians have fun improvising, leaving the last part to a series of shapeless noises à la radio-frequency-signal style (well, I had to try to explain it lol).
The album flows like a charm. It is very direct and for this reason enchanting. Plus, it's well played: they are not the usual 4 kids grabbing a couple of sticks, some picks, and deciding to make a racket.
At times they remind me of Incubus, for the taste, precision, and the particularly melodic line of the singer Gavin Hayes (hey, at 2:09 of Lechium he really sounds like Brandon Boyd!).
